I'm going to be as fair as I can here. Tool is my favorite band, and has been for almost 3 decades. I've seen every video of theirs about 2000 times. My MMO characters are all named something Tool related (at least until i get reported for them) It's a pretty obvious inspiration at the very most charitable. If you would have told me this was a Tool video, I would have believed it instantly, no hesitation at all. That's how similar they are. It isn't just that it is stop motion, but the general decrepit scenery, the rusty screws, the creatures with unfinished or undressed limbs, the quick flashing objects moving around... It isn't Identical, in a literal sense, but wow. I had no idea this existed until just now. They even used the creepy baby heads in Prison Sex. It's so thematic and aesthetically similar. It hurts me to say this, but they are right. It's close enough to warrant credit. Adam still created something wonderfully dark, and he definitely put an aura of intention behind the animation itself that makes it incredible. The slick black hand pushing the doll down and caressing it as it thrashed is pure genius. The box that the puppet digs up and opens right before blacking out was powerful, too. If there was NO music, those videos would still be masterpieces. The fact that they line up so well with the music AND the lyrics makes it almost indescribably perfect. The Sober video looks like it sounds, if that makes sense. You can see the frayed distortion and whining feedback. You can hear the puppet's misery and wailing depression in Maynard's voice. The frantic search for relief, and the sickness that prompted it, is heard in every tempo change. I would still enjoy it if they had stolen the whole thing shot for shot, which they didnt do. Even so, there is no way to deny the similarities. We aren't talking about "Hey, I used those same 4 chords in my song!" here. Lots of songs have the same chords, so we tend to judge similarities using more narrow criteria. "They stole that drum beat" or "They stole that guitar riff" The Quay brothers created a unique vision, so Adam couldn't have gotten their style and atmosphere anywhere else. There is a direct line from the Quay Brothers to Tool, so it wasnt like it was already popular. It is definitely close enough to deserve being credited. Maybe they already credited the Quay Brothers and we just don't see it.
